39.63 cm (15.6 in) model This section provides preset display resolutions and preset timing resolutions. Table A-2 Preset display resolutions Preset Pixel format Horz freq (kHz) Vert freq (Hz) 1 640 × 480 2 720 × 400 3 800 × 600 4 1024 × 768 5 1280 × 720 6 1280 × 800 7 1280 × 1024 8 1366 × 768 9 1440 × 900 10 1600 × 900 11 1600 × 1200 12 1680 × 1050 13 1920 × 1080 31.469 31.469 37.879 48.363 45.000 49.702 63.981 47.712 55.935 60.000 75.000 65.290 67.500 59.940 70.087 60.317 60.004 60.000 59.810 60.020 59.790 59.887 60.000 60.000 59.954 60.000 Table A-3 Preset timing resolutions Preset Timing name 1 480p 2 576p 3 720p50 4 720p60 5 1080p60 6 1080p50 Pixel format 640 × 480 720 × 576 1280 × 720 1280 × 720 1920 × 1080 1920 × 1080 Horz freq (kHz) 31.469 31.250 37.500 45.000 67.500 56.250 Vert freq (Hz) 59.940 50 50 60 60 50 Energy saver feature This monitor supports a reduced power state. The reduced power state is initiated if the monitor detects the absence of either the horizontal sync signal or the vertical sync signal. Upon detecting the absence of these signals, the monitor screen is blank, the backlight is turned off, and the power light turns amber. In the reduced power state, the monitor uses < 0.5 W of power. There is a brief warm-up period before the monitor returns to its normal operating state. See the computer manual for instructions on setting the energy saver mode (sometimes called "power management feature"). 20 Appendix A Technical specifications
